O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S

O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S

1.ON/OFF

Plug in the power cord to the AC power outlet.

Turn on the main power switch located on the back of the subwoofer. When the Power indicator on the front panel turns to red, the system is on the STANDBY mode. Press the POWER button located on the front panel of the subwoofer or the STANDBY button located on the remote control to turn on the system. The Power indicator is in blue color when the system is on.

2. INPUT SELECT

Press the buttons (DVD/5.1, STEREO, AUX1, AUX2) located on the remote control to select audio source. The selected audio source will be shown on the LED display.

Note: For the best sound quality, it is recommended to select 2-channel input STEREO if your audio source is CD, MP3 or VCD.

3. OUTPUT SELECT

Press the buttons (2.1CH or 5.1CH) for the music preference.

4. VOLUME AND FINE TUNING

The main volume can be adjusted by the MASTER VOL. located the remote control.

5. MUTE

Press the MUTE button on the remote control, the system goes into mute mode with the MUTE indicator shown on the LED display. Press the MUTE button again to disable the mute mode.

6. RESET

Press the RESET button on the remote control, the system will be reset to factory's default setting.

7. BALANCE:

Press the L and R buttons on the remote control to adjust the balance level between the left and right channel.
